An original pair of British Army Denim Battledress Trousers dated 1944 which are a size No. 6. This pattern of trousers came into issue with the British Army during the Second World War and remained standard issue well into the 1950s. Thesy were used for fatigues and are made from a green coloured denim sanforized cotton, typical of that used for workwear in the mid century period. Based on the serge battledress design, these trousers feature a map pocket to the left leg, a first field dressing pocket to the right hip and slash pockets in the usual place in each side seam and no through pockets as seen on post-war examples. They are cut with a high rise and wide leg as were all men’s clothes during this period. This particular pair still retains their original manufacturer’s label to the exterior of the seat. It bears the title of ‘Overalls Trousers, Denim’ and states the size as No. 6 which is designed to fit someone with a 34-35′ waist. The maker’s name of ‘N. N. Taylor & Co Ltd’ is also present as is the War Department broad arrow marking and the 1944 date. It is important to remember that these are designed to fit over the wool battledress trousers so need to be worn oversize for an authentic fit.
